Title :
Performance requirements for the transport of MPEG video streams over ATM networks

Abstract :
We study the performance requirements for the transport of MPEG video streams over ATM networks. The use of two different schemes is studied to overcome the loss of information when transferring video sequences through ATM networks. In the first scheme, the prioritization scheme assigns different priorities to the video stream based on the different types of video frames. In the second scheme, the use of dummy cells to replace the lost ATM cells is investigated. For this second scheme, different patterns for the dummy cells to be used are investigated. Statistics of signal to noise ratio (SNR) for cell loss ratio (CLR) in each case are presented. Statistics gathered from both types of schemes can be applied in several ways to network design and operation
